As far as I'm concerned, here is the most important safety related reason to have Neutral:

In icy conditions when you are in a skid, you need to take your foot off the gas, shift into Neutral and steer out. By shifting into neutral, you are stopping all forward drive to the wheels and you gain more control over the car.
